Hi!
I work in a small company where we do event security, safety and general staff. We use O365 for our fix staff, they all have an account.
For longer events we would like to setup a laptop that is used by the current chief of staff or supervisor to deal with check-in lists etc. The files are stored in a Sharepoint document library.
Now I would like to connect the OneDrive client on this laptop with the document library (and sync it) but also limit the access to only this one document library. If I sign in to the OneDrive client with my own account I can sync the document library but with only one click I can also sync my whole OneDrive. As different people will use this laptop it is not acceptable that they could access my personal OneDrive with one click.
Is there any solution to limit the access of the client?
